The Essentials In Saltwater Fishing Reels

 

Fishing is a great hobby that provides relaxation but also huge rewards for those who take the time to master their skills. Every type of fish needs a special approach because of the surroundings, type of water they are in and habits. Having the right gear and knowing how to use it makes the whole difference in the end; here are some of the essentials to look for when shopping for saltwater fishing reels. The main things to consider when shopping for saltwater fishing reels are: obtaining fishing experience and knowledge about using the gear, the type of fish you will be fishing and last but not least the type of fishing you will be practicing. There are two main types of saltwater fishing reels to choose from and they are: bait casting and spinning.

Types of Reels

The bait casting saltwater fishing reels is mostly for the experienced anglers because they can handle heavier lines for larger fish types; they lines retrieves on the spool directly, which makes working with it a challenge for beginners but with practice one will learn to cast the more extremely accurate. The bait casting saltwater fishing reels are designed in one piece to lessen the corrosive effects. The spinning saltwater fishing reels is more open faced with stationary design spool to keep the line in place by even the most inexperienced of anglers. You will find most saltwater fishing reels designed according to the particular type of fishing you practice, for example: bottom reels, casting reels, jigging reels and offshore reels.
